# Unveiling the Mysteries of Random Text Random text, seemingly nonsensical sequences of characters, often serves as a placeholder or a tool for various purposes in design, development, and testing. Its origins trace back to the early days of printing, where typesetters used "Lorem Ipsum," a scrambled Latin passage, to demonstrate the appearance of fonts and layouts without distracting the reader with meaningful content. ## The Evolution of Randomness Over time, the concept of [random text](https://talkwithstranger.com/free-chat-rooms/text-strangers) expanded beyond Lorem Ipsum. Developers created algorithms to generate strings of random characters, words, or even sentences. These strings mimic the structure of human language, albeit devoid of semantic meaning, and are utilized across various industries. ## Applications in Design and Development In design, random text helps visualize layouts and designs without the need for real content. Designers can assess the visual impact of different fonts, sizes, and layouts before finalizing the content. Similarly, in software development, developers use random text to test the functionality and appearance of user interfaces without relying on actual data. ## Lorem Ipsum Alternatives While Lorem Ipsum remains popular, numerous alternatives have emerged, catering to different needs and preferences.
